How Markup Merger runs
Ingest
Lawrs parses the source set, resolves document families, and builds a citation index so every later statement can point back to a page and paragraph.
Analyse
Markup Merger runs its redlining pass across the indexed set, recording the reasoning behind each finding rather than only the conclusion.
Verify
Findings are re-checked against the underlying text. Anything the model cannot ground in a source is surfaced as unverified rather than quietly dropped.
Hand off
Output lands in the format the next person needs, with the audit trail attached so a reviewer can confirm the work in minutes.
